Job Description

A fantastic opportunity has arisen for a Deputy Registered Manager to join a warm, child‑centred residential service supporting children and young people aged 8–17 who have experienced trauma, disrupted attachments, and emotional or behavioural challenges.

You’ll be joining a well‑established, nurturing provider committed to delivering high‑quality, therapeutic care within a homely, stable environment. The home prides itself on consistency, positive relationships, and helping young people build resilience and achieve meaningful progress.

Working closely with the Registered Manager, you’ll play a key role in leading the team, shaping practice, and ensuring the home continues to meet the highest standards of care and compliance.

Key responsibilities

  • Support the Registered Manager in the day‑to‑day running of the home, ensuring it operates in line with Children’s Homes Regulations and Quality Standards.
  • Provide strong leadership to the staff team, modelling best practice, supervising staff, and promoting a positive, child‑focused culture.
  • Oversee care planning, risk assessments, and behaviour support strategies to ensure young people receive safe, consistent, and therapeutic care.
  • Contribute to audits, quality assurance processes, and regulatory compliance, ensuring the home is always inspection‑ready.
  • Build effective relationships with young people, families, professionals, and external agencies to promote positive outcomes and stability.
  • Support with rota management, recruitment, training, and development of the team.

Essential requirements

  • Level 3 Diploma in Residential Childcare (or equivalent) – Level 5 Leadership & Management desirable or willingness to work towards it.
  • Strong understanding of Children’s Homes Regulations (2015) and Quality Standards.
  • Experience working within a children’s residential setting, ideally in a senior or supervisory role.
  • Ability to lead, motivate, and develop a team.
  • Full UK driving licence.
